This is the old XigmaNAS forum in read only mode,
it will taken offline by the end of march 2021!
I like to aks Users and Admins to rewrite/take over important post from here into the new fresh main forum!
Its not possible for us to export from here and import it to the main forum!
it will taken offline by the end of march 2021!
I like to aks Users and Admins to rewrite/take over important post from here into the new fresh main forum!
Its not possible for us to export from here and import it to the main forum!
Taille du NAS qui n'augmente pas en upgradant les disques
Moderators: velivole18, ernie, mtiburs
-
CorbeilleNews
- Advanced User

- Posts: 261
- Joined: 04 Jul 2012 20:40
- Status: Offline
Taille du NAS qui n'augmente pas en upgradant les disques
Bonjour,
Je ne comprend pas pourquoi sur un NAS en RAID-Z2 de 6 disques (5 disques de 4 To et 1 disque de 250 Go), la taille du NAS ne s'upgrade pas à la fin du resilvered lorsque je remplace le petit disque de 250 go par un sixième disque de 4 To strictement identique aux 5 autres !!! Et si je fais un RAID-Z2 directement avec les 6 disques de 4 To pas de soucis.
Je pose cette question car je dois faire la même manip sur un plus gros NAS (en RAID-Z2 également) c'est à dire upgrader 10 disques de 2 To par 10 disques de 4 To et je n'ai pas le droit à l'erreur.
Ce premier NAS est en quelques sorte pour tester la manœuvre pour l'upgrade du plus gros.
Merci de votre aide.
Je ne comprend pas pourquoi sur un NAS en RAID-Z2 de 6 disques (5 disques de 4 To et 1 disque de 250 Go), la taille du NAS ne s'upgrade pas à la fin du resilvered lorsque je remplace le petit disque de 250 go par un sixième disque de 4 To strictement identique aux 5 autres !!! Et si je fais un RAID-Z2 directement avec les 6 disques de 4 To pas de soucis.
Je pose cette question car je dois faire la même manip sur un plus gros NAS (en RAID-Z2 également) c'est à dire upgrader 10 disques de 2 To par 10 disques de 4 To et je n'ai pas le droit à l'erreur.
Ce premier NAS est en quelques sorte pour tester la manœuvre pour l'upgrade du plus gros.
Merci de votre aide.
-
sleid
- PowerUser

- Posts: 774
- Joined: 23 Jun 2012 07:36
- Location: FRANCE LIMOUSIN CORREZE
- Status: Offline
Re: Taille du NAS qui n'augmente pas en upgradant les disque
Bonjour
La meilleur solution avant "d'agrandir" un pool avec des disques de plus grande capacité est de placer autoexpand à ON
zpool set autoexpand=on
Dans ce cas la nouvelle capacité du disque est prise en compte automatiquement.
Dans votre cas non seulement il faut mettre autoexpand à ON (zpool set autoexpand=on)
mais en plus il faut mettre online le disque en cause avec l'option -e (expand) même s'il est déjà en ligne (zpool online -e mon_pool mon_disque)
La meilleur solution avant "d'agrandir" un pool avec des disques de plus grande capacité est de placer autoexpand à ON
zpool set autoexpand=on
Dans ce cas la nouvelle capacité du disque est prise en compte automatiquement.
Dans votre cas non seulement il faut mettre autoexpand à ON (zpool set autoexpand=on)
mais en plus il faut mettre online le disque en cause avec l'option -e (expand) même s'il est déjà en ligne (zpool online -e mon_pool mon_disque)
12.1.0.4 - Ingva (revision 7852)
FreeBSD 12.1-RELEASE-p12 #0 r368465M: Tue Dec 8 23:25:11 CET 2020
X64-embedded sur Intel(R) Atom(TM) CPU C2750 @ 2.40GHz Boot UEFI
ASRock C2750D4I 2 X 8GB DDR3 ECC
Pool of 2 vdev Raidz1: 3 WDC WD40EFRX + 3 WDC WD40EFRX
FreeBSD 12.1-RELEASE-p12 #0 r368465M: Tue Dec 8 23:25:11 CET 2020
X64-embedded sur Intel(R) Atom(TM) CPU C2750 @ 2.40GHz Boot UEFI
ASRock C2750D4I 2 X 8GB DDR3 ECC
Pool of 2 vdev Raidz1: 3 WDC WD40EFRX + 3 WDC WD40EFRX
-
CorbeilleNews
- Advanced User

- Posts: 261
- Joined: 04 Jul 2012 20:40
- Status: Offline
Re: Taille du NAS qui n'augmente pas en upgradant les disque
Je ne sais pas comment ni ou rentrer cette commande : je ne sais utiliser que la WEBGUI mais je veux bien apprendrezpool set autoexpand=on
Merci
-
sleid
- PowerUser

- Posts: 774
- Joined: 23 Jun 2012 07:36
- Location: FRANCE LIMOUSIN CORREZE
- Status: Offline
Re: Taille du NAS qui n'augmente pas en upgradant les disque
Webgui
Avancé|Exécuter une commande
Coller la commande puis exécuter.
Ou sur le nas directement en utilisant le shell (cette méthode est de loin ma préférée pour les actions "lourdes")
Ou avec Putty
Avancé|Exécuter une commande
Coller la commande puis exécuter.
Ou sur le nas directement en utilisant le shell (cette méthode est de loin ma préférée pour les actions "lourdes")
Ou avec Putty
12.1.0.4 - Ingva (revision 7852)
FreeBSD 12.1-RELEASE-p12 #0 r368465M: Tue Dec 8 23:25:11 CET 2020
X64-embedded sur Intel(R) Atom(TM) CPU C2750 @ 2.40GHz Boot UEFI
ASRock C2750D4I 2 X 8GB DDR3 ECC
Pool of 2 vdev Raidz1: 3 WDC WD40EFRX + 3 WDC WD40EFRX
FreeBSD 12.1-RELEASE-p12 #0 r368465M: Tue Dec 8 23:25:11 CET 2020
X64-embedded sur Intel(R) Atom(TM) CPU C2750 @ 2.40GHz Boot UEFI
ASRock C2750D4I 2 X 8GB DDR3 ECC
Pool of 2 vdev Raidz1: 3 WDC WD40EFRX + 3 WDC WD40EFRX
-
CorbeilleNews
- Advanced User

- Posts: 261
- Joined: 04 Jul 2012 20:40
- Status: Offline
Re: Taille du NAS qui n'augmente pas en upgradant les disque
Je prefère eviter le menu executer une commande vu l'avertissement dans la WEBGUI
Le shell c'est sur l'écran du NAS directement là ou le curseur clignote quand le NAS à fini de démarrer ? Je tape 6 et je fait entrer puis je tape la commande ?
Merci
Le shell c'est sur l'écran du NAS directement là ou le curseur clignote quand le NAS à fini de démarrer ? Je tape 6 et je fait entrer puis je tape la commande ?
Merci
-
sleid
- PowerUser

- Posts: 774
- Joined: 23 Jun 2012 07:36
- Location: FRANCE LIMOUSIN CORREZE
- Status: Offline
Re: Taille du NAS qui n'augmente pas en upgradant les disque
oui, mais ça fonctionne aussi avec le webgui
12.1.0.4 - Ingva (revision 7852)
FreeBSD 12.1-RELEASE-p12 #0 r368465M: Tue Dec 8 23:25:11 CET 2020
X64-embedded sur Intel(R) Atom(TM) CPU C2750 @ 2.40GHz Boot UEFI
ASRock C2750D4I 2 X 8GB DDR3 ECC
Pool of 2 vdev Raidz1: 3 WDC WD40EFRX + 3 WDC WD40EFRX
FreeBSD 12.1-RELEASE-p12 #0 r368465M: Tue Dec 8 23:25:11 CET 2020
X64-embedded sur Intel(R) Atom(TM) CPU C2750 @ 2.40GHz Boot UEFI
ASRock C2750D4I 2 X 8GB DDR3 ECC
Pool of 2 vdev Raidz1: 3 WDC WD40EFRX + 3 WDC WD40EFRX
-
CorbeilleNews
- Advanced User

- Posts: 261
- Joined: 04 Jul 2012 20:40
- Status: Offline
Re: Taille du NAS qui n'augmente pas en upgradant les disque
Si veux parler du menu avancé / commande dans le WebGUI cela me gêne un peu car j'ai le message suivant qui reste impressionnant ! : Note: Cette fonction n'est pas maintenue. Vous l'utilisez à vos propres risques!
Je vais plutôt essayer sur le shell
Je vais plutôt essayer sur le shell
-
CorbeilleNews
- Advanced User

- Posts: 261
- Joined: 04 Jul 2012 20:40
- Status: Offline
Re: Taille du NAS qui n'augmente pas en upgradant les disque
Cela à fonctionné je te remercie beaucoup.
J'ai du mal à comprendre pourquoi il faut mettre le nouveau disque online ? Je pensais que le nouveaux disque se substituait à l'ancien qui lui était déjà online et donc pas utile de le faire.
A quoi correspond le online ?
J'ai un vague souvenir d'avoir fais juste l'opération "replace" et que la nouvelle capacité s'était opérée automatiquement juste après le resilvering, bizarre non ? Aurais-je manqué quelques chose ?
Merci encore
J'ai du mal à comprendre pourquoi il faut mettre le nouveau disque online ? Je pensais que le nouveaux disque se substituait à l'ancien qui lui était déjà online et donc pas utile de le faire.
A quoi correspond le online ?
J'ai un vague souvenir d'avoir fais juste l'opération "replace" et que la nouvelle capacité s'était opérée automatiquement juste après le resilvering, bizarre non ? Aurais-je manqué quelques chose ?
Merci encore
-
sleid
- PowerUser

- Posts: 774
- Joined: 23 Jun 2012 07:36
- Location: FRANCE LIMOUSIN CORREZE
- Status: Offline
Re: Taille du NAS qui n'augmente pas en upgradant les disque
C'est online -e si autoexpand n'était pas "ON" avant de changer le disque.
12.1.0.4 - Ingva (revision 7852)
FreeBSD 12.1-RELEASE-p12 #0 r368465M: Tue Dec 8 23:25:11 CET 2020
X64-embedded sur Intel(R) Atom(TM) CPU C2750 @ 2.40GHz Boot UEFI
ASRock C2750D4I 2 X 8GB DDR3 ECC
Pool of 2 vdev Raidz1: 3 WDC WD40EFRX + 3 WDC WD40EFRX
FreeBSD 12.1-RELEASE-p12 #0 r368465M: Tue Dec 8 23:25:11 CET 2020
X64-embedded sur Intel(R) Atom(TM) CPU C2750 @ 2.40GHz Boot UEFI
ASRock C2750D4I 2 X 8GB DDR3 ECC
Pool of 2 vdev Raidz1: 3 WDC WD40EFRX + 3 WDC WD40EFRX
-
CorbeilleNews
- Advanced User

- Posts: 261
- Joined: 04 Jul 2012 20:40
- Status: Offline
Re: Taille du NAS qui n'augmente pas en upgradant les disque
Si j'ai bien compris dans mon premier essai dont je parle plus haut autoexpand devait être sur ON sans que je le sache ?
Comment fait-on pour savoir si il est on ou pas ?
Merci
Comment fait-on pour savoir si il est on ou pas ?
Merci
-
sleid
- PowerUser

- Posts: 774
- Joined: 23 Jun 2012 07:36
- Location: FRANCE LIMOUSIN CORREZE
- Status: Offline
Re: Taille du NAS qui n'augmente pas en upgradant les disque
zpool get autoexpand
réponse s'il est ON:
NAME PROPERTY VALUE SOURCE
Nas4Free autoexpand on local
réponse s'il est ON:
NAME PROPERTY VALUE SOURCE
Nas4Free autoexpand on local
12.1.0.4 - Ingva (revision 7852)
FreeBSD 12.1-RELEASE-p12 #0 r368465M: Tue Dec 8 23:25:11 CET 2020
X64-embedded sur Intel(R) Atom(TM) CPU C2750 @ 2.40GHz Boot UEFI
ASRock C2750D4I 2 X 8GB DDR3 ECC
Pool of 2 vdev Raidz1: 3 WDC WD40EFRX + 3 WDC WD40EFRX
FreeBSD 12.1-RELEASE-p12 #0 r368465M: Tue Dec 8 23:25:11 CET 2020
X64-embedded sur Intel(R) Atom(TM) CPU C2750 @ 2.40GHz Boot UEFI
ASRock C2750D4I 2 X 8GB DDR3 ECC
Pool of 2 vdev Raidz1: 3 WDC WD40EFRX + 3 WDC WD40EFRX
-
CorbeilleNews
- Advanced User

- Posts: 261
- Joined: 04 Jul 2012 20:40
- Status: Offline
Re: Taille du NAS qui n'augmente pas en upgradant les disque
Pour ceux que cela intéresserais j'ai mis ici les problèmes auquels j'ai été confronté et qui m'ont permis d'avancer non sans mal vers cet upgrade.
Merci à Sleid (pour qui j'ai encore quelques questions à la fin du post
)
Je n'arrivais pas a mettre autoexpand sur ON avec la commande : zpool set autoexpand=on
En fait il fallait ajouter le nom du Pool dans la ligne de commande :
zpool set autoexpand=on NonDuPool
puis faire
zpool get autoexpand NomduPool
Par contre je viens d'essayer de remplacer un disque de 2To par un 4To dans le gros NAS et quand j'ai lancé le replace (en WEBGUI) j'ai eu le message d'erreur suivant que je n'avais pas eu sur le NAS d'essai :
invalid vdev specification
use '-f' to override the following errors:
/dev/ada11.nop is part of potentially active pool 'Pool'
Le nom du Pool constitué par (entre autre) ce disque dans la machine de test était "Pool" comme indiqué à la fin du message d'erreur
Je pense qu'il devait rester sur ce disque des traces du Pool constitué dans le NAS de test (mais cela peut dans d'autres cas venir d'ailleurs si vous n'utilisez pas des disques neufs mais des disques ayant déjà servi) alors j'ai nettoyé complètement le MBR et refais la même manip et le resilvering s'est mis en route automatiquement pour ... quelques heures
Par contre y a t-il des précautions (du style sauvegarde de configuration ou autre sauvegarde de Pool ou je ne sais quoi d'autres...) à prendre (au cas ou l'autoexpand ne fonctionnerait pas après la fin du resilvering du 10ème disque de 4 To du second NAS) afin de revenir à des disques de 2To ?
Merci encore
Merci à Sleid (pour qui j'ai encore quelques questions à la fin du post
Je n'arrivais pas a mettre autoexpand sur ON avec la commande : zpool set autoexpand=on
En fait il fallait ajouter le nom du Pool dans la ligne de commande :
zpool set autoexpand=on NonDuPool
puis faire
zpool get autoexpand NomduPool
Par contre je viens d'essayer de remplacer un disque de 2To par un 4To dans le gros NAS et quand j'ai lancé le replace (en WEBGUI) j'ai eu le message d'erreur suivant que je n'avais pas eu sur le NAS d'essai :
invalid vdev specification
use '-f' to override the following errors:
/dev/ada11.nop is part of potentially active pool 'Pool'
Le nom du Pool constitué par (entre autre) ce disque dans la machine de test était "Pool" comme indiqué à la fin du message d'erreur
Je pense qu'il devait rester sur ce disque des traces du Pool constitué dans le NAS de test (mais cela peut dans d'autres cas venir d'ailleurs si vous n'utilisez pas des disques neufs mais des disques ayant déjà servi) alors j'ai nettoyé complètement le MBR et refais la même manip et le resilvering s'est mis en route automatiquement pour ... quelques heures
Par contre y a t-il des précautions (du style sauvegarde de configuration ou autre sauvegarde de Pool ou je ne sais quoi d'autres...) à prendre (au cas ou l'autoexpand ne fonctionnerait pas après la fin du resilvering du 10ème disque de 4 To du second NAS) afin de revenir à des disques de 2To ?
Merci encore
-
sleid
- PowerUser

- Posts: 774
- Joined: 23 Jun 2012 07:36
- Location: FRANCE LIMOUSIN CORREZE
- Status: Offline
Re: Taille du NAS qui n'augmente pas en upgradant les disque
Dans les commandes le nom du pool est nécessaire si l'on a plusieurs pool(s) ou si le disque a des restes d'un ancien pool.
Dans le cas d'une destruction de pool (zfs destroy) on peut encore récupérer ce pool ceci pour vous expliquer qu'il faut toujours nettoyer les restes de métadata avant d'utiliser un disque pour un nouveau pool.
Dans le cas d'une destruction de pool (zfs destroy) on peut encore récupérer ce pool ceci pour vous expliquer qu'il faut toujours nettoyer les restes de métadata avant d'utiliser un disque pour un nouveau pool.
12.1.0.4 - Ingva (revision 7852)
FreeBSD 12.1-RELEASE-p12 #0 r368465M: Tue Dec 8 23:25:11 CET 2020
X64-embedded sur Intel(R) Atom(TM) CPU C2750 @ 2.40GHz Boot UEFI
ASRock C2750D4I 2 X 8GB DDR3 ECC
Pool of 2 vdev Raidz1: 3 WDC WD40EFRX + 3 WDC WD40EFRX
FreeBSD 12.1-RELEASE-p12 #0 r368465M: Tue Dec 8 23:25:11 CET 2020
X64-embedded sur Intel(R) Atom(TM) CPU C2750 @ 2.40GHz Boot UEFI
ASRock C2750D4I 2 X 8GB DDR3 ECC
Pool of 2 vdev Raidz1: 3 WDC WD40EFRX + 3 WDC WD40EFRX